Why Children’s Eye Exams Are Important

Healthy vision supports every aspect of childhood development, from learning to social confidence. Many eye conditions in children don’t show obvious symptoms right away, making annual exams an important safeguard. Early detection means easier treatment and better outcomes, giving children the foundation for lifelong vision health.

Our eye doctor recommends that children receive their first exam by age four and continue with yearly visits to monitor changes as they grow.

What to Expect During a Pediatric Exam

Our exams are calm and stress-free, with each step explained in clear, child-friendly terms. Dr. Rana evaluates:

  • Visual clarity and focusing ability

  • Eye alignment and coordination

  • Prescription needs for glasses or contact lenses

  • Overall eye health with advanced diagnostic imaging

Parents are encouraged to take part during the exam, ensuring children feel supported while helping families understand results and next step

Common Childhood Vision Concerns

Our optometrist will often check for conditions that may affect learning and daily activities:

  • Nearsightedness (myopia)

  • Farsightedness (hyperopia)

  • Astigmatism

  • Crossed eyes (strabismus)

  • Lazy eye (amblyopia

Myopia Management for Children

Myopia, or nearsightedness, is one of the most common concerns in childhood eyecare, and it tends to worsen as children grow. Left untreated, progressive myopia can lead to higher prescriptions and increase the risk of eye disease in adulthood.

Our treatment options include:

  • MiSight® contact lenses: FDA-approved daily lenses clinically proven to slow the progression of myopia.

  • Low-dose atropine therapy: Gentle medicated eye drops that help reduce the rate of nearsightedness in children.

  • Essilor® Stellest™ lenses: Help slow myopia progression. Offering clear vision and long-term eye protection in a comfortable, kid-friendly design.

  • By addressing myopia early, we can help children enjoy clearer vision now while protecting their long-term eye health.
